## Timezone change for DanaRv2, DanaRS
915

10-
These pumps need a special care because AAPS is using history from the pump but the records in pump don't have timezone stamp. **That means if you simple change timezone in phone, records will be read with different timezone and will be doubled.**
16+
These pumps require special care because **AAPS** uses history from the pump but the records in pump do not have timezone stamp. **This means that if you change time zone in your phone, records will be read with different time zone and will be doubled.**
1117

1218
To avoid this there are two possibilities:

## Timezone Change for Insight
4652

4753
The driver automatically adjusts the time of the pump to the time of the phone.
4854

49-
The Insight also records the history entries in which moment time was changed and from which (old) time to which (new) time. So the correct time can be determined in AAPS despite the time change.
55+
The Insight also records the history entries in which moment time was changed and from which (old) time to which (new) time. So the correct time can be determined in **AAPS** despite the time change.
5056

51-
It may cause inaccuracies in the TDDs. But it shouldn't be a problem.
57+
It may cause inaccuracies in the **TDDs**. But it shouldn't be a problem.
5258

5359
So the Insight user doesn't have to worry about timezone changes and time changes. There is one exception to this rule: The Insight pump has a small internal battery to power time etc. while you are changing the "real" battery. If changing battery takes to long this internal battery runs out of energy, the clock is reset and you are asked to enter time and date after inserting a new battery. In this case all entries prior to the battery change are skipped in calculation in AAPS as the correct time cannot be identified properly.

## Accu-Chek Combo
61+
## Timezone Change for Accu-Chek Combo
5662

5763
The [new Combo driver](../CompatiblePumps/Accu-Chek-Combo-Pump-v2.md) automatically adjusts the time of the pump to the time of the phone. The Combo cannot store timezones, only local time, which is precisely what the new driver programs into the pump. In addition, it stores the timezone in the local AAPS preferences to be able to convert the pump's localtime to a full timestamp that has a timezone offset. The user does not have to do anything; if the time on the Combo deviates too much from the phone's current time, the pump's time is automatically adjusted.
5864

5965
Note that this takes some time, however, since it can only be done in the remote-terminal mode, which is generally slow. This is a Combo limitation that cannot be overcome.
6066

6167
The old, Ruffy-based driver does not adjust the time automatically. The user has to do that manually. See below for the steps necessary to do that safely in case the timezone / daylight savings is the reason for the change.

## DAYLIGHT SAVING (DST)
79+
Time adjustment daylight savings time
80+
81+
Depending on your pump and CGM setup, jumps in time can lead to problems with **AAPS** to function correctlyy.
82+
For instance with the Combo pump, the pump history is read twice leading to duplicate entries. For some pumps it is better to make time zone adjustments while awake and not during the night.
83+
84+
85+
### DST automatic adjustment for most pumps
86+
87+
* This adjustment feature is available for **AAPS** version 2.2 onwards.
88+
* Howeever, the fully closed Loop will be deactivated for 3 hours AFTER the DST switch (usually 1am onwards) has taken place and **AAPS** will default to background basal as selected in your **Profile**.
89+
This is done for safety reasons - **IOB** may be too high due to duplicated bolus prior to DST change.
90+
* After DST has taken place, select **Profile Switch** to user's desired **Profile** to enable fully closed Loop.
91+
* You will also receive a notification on **AAPS** main screen prior to DST change that the Fully Closed Loop has been disabled temporarily. This message will appear without beep, vibration or anything.**
92+
93+
94+
If you bolus with **AAPS'** calculator please do not use **COB** and **IOB** data unless you are sure this data is absolutely correct. Take caution and do not use this feature for a couple of hours after DST switch has taken place.
